Ind. Code § 33-24-6-13
Report concerning enforcement of residential complex
As added by P.L.38-2016, SEC.3. Amended by P.L.161-2018, SEC.66; P.L.135-2021, SEC.3.
(a) Beginning in 2018, not later than March 1 of each year, the office of judicial administration shall submit a report to the legislative council in an electronic format under IC 5-14-6 providing the following information relating to the enforcement of residential complex traffic ordinances on the property of residential complexes under contracts entered into under IC 9-21-18-4.3 :
- (1) The number of traffic stops.
- (2) The number of citations issued.
- (3) The number of traffic stops and citations issued.
- (b) The report must set forth information required under subsection
(a) by:
(1) each unit that has adopted a residential complex traffic ordinance:
- (A) under IC 9-21-18-4.3 ; and
- (B) through issuance of electronic traffic tickets (as defined in IC 9-30-3-2.5 ); and
- (2) the totals for all units described in subdivision (1).
- (c) The office of judicial administration must issue a report under this section for each of the following years:
- (1) 2017.
- (2) 2018.
- (3) 2019.
- (4) 2020.
- (5) 2021.
- (6) 2022.
- (7) 2023.
- (8) 2024.
- (9) 2025.
- (10) 2026.
